As a Midjourney AI user I'd like to see some solutions to this problem.
For a start force the release of the databases used by AI art generators and (if possible) release data about how many images have been generated using each scraped artist's copyrighted material. Then provide compensation to each artist. Going forward ensure that all images used are opted-in by the artist so they can be paid either royalties every time their work is used in an AI generated image or provided a one-off fee, or nothing if the artist waives their right.
I think all parties would agree this is fair?
However the problem going forward is that AI is getting better at an exponential rate and may need fewer and fewer images as a base going forward and soon they may not need any recognised artist's work in order to function as well or better as they are doing currently. All the more reason to substantially compensate the artists whose work went into the original databases.
I pay $60 a month to use Midjourney (non commercially - for fun) and would happily pay double that if I knew that most of it was going towards paying artists what they are owed.
